So, I stumbled across this article on BBC about stealing wireless connections. Having myself been participant to many such an occasion, it's certainly an interesting moral debate. I found this reader response in particular very funny:
The rich neighbor found his poor neighbor salivating outside of his kitchen window from the aroma of his food. The rich neighbor demanded payment for the smell of the food. The poor neighbor took some coins from his pocket and said: "I'll pay for the smell of your food with the sound of counting my money".
Exactly! Why should it be illegal to use something that invades your space? Throw some apples into my balcony and I'll take them!
